BJP State President Damu Naik on Friday announced that the party is set to introduce at least 80 percent fresh faces in the upcoming Zilla Panchayat (ZP) elections. Emphasizing the BJP’s structure as an organisation-driven party, Naik said candidate selection will be based primarily on two criteria — winnability and the candidate’s public appeal.
He further revealed that the party has already taken key decisions regarding the selection process, and the final list of probable candidates will be released within the next four to five days.
Naik added that the BJP aims to strike a balance between new leadership and grassroots support, ensuring strong representation across constituencies for the upcoming polls.
